Russian-born singer/songwriter Marina V is a young and charismatic pop artist with an incredible life story and a “hauntingly beautiful” sound (L.A. Times). Marina’s music is “melodic and passionate” (The Washington Post), which combined with her “voice of an angel” (The Prague Post) and her rich cultural background makes this artist truly special. “If the Beatles and Tori Amos had a child raised in Russia by Tchaikovsky, that would be me,” muses the piano-playing chanteuse, describing her musical influences. Now a true California girl, the red-headed songstress grew up in Moscow, blessed with a beautiful voice and a long last name (Verenikina).

Raised by a communist nuclear physicist father and a psychologist mother during the difficult time of the Soviet Union collapse, Marina attended a school of music every evening after regular school, and has written songs since early childhood. When Marina turned 15, she won a prestigious scholarship and came to America by herself. Somewhere between visa issues, crazy odd jobs, missing her family, playing ice hockey and attending University in Illinois, Marina began pursuing her musical dreams by touring and self-releasing her music and upon graduating from college, moved to los Angeles. Since then, marina has blossomed into an international voice, relentlessly touring and performing at venues such as Hollywood’s Kodak Theatre, the American Embassy in Mowcow, and clubs from Paris to Sydney. She has written theme songs for films like “Fallen Idol” (narrated by Elliot Gould) and “Truth About Kenny” (which just won best original screenplay at the LA Femme International Film Festival) and has had her songs on tv (NBC’s Days of Our Lives and CBS’s The Good Wife, etc. ) and games (iPhone’s #1 game, Tap Tap Revenge).

Marina has just completed her new album, MY STAR, sponsored entirely by her fans (having raised almost $30,000 from devoted listeners via marinav.com) and produced by the renowned producer Guy Erez (Gipsy Kings, Ryan Cabrera, etc.). From catchy pop hit sounds of “You Make Me Beautiful” to a surprise cover of Guns ‘N Roses smash “Don’t Cry”, the 10-song album features celebrity guests from bands KISS and Collective Soul, and includes a stunning a capella performance of a Russian traditional song, Tonkaya Ryabina. Supported by her loyal fans, marina is getting more and more recognition each day. The environmentally-conscious self-described cultural ambassador is always on tour, connecting with her fans and inspiring people with her amazing music, unusual story and beautiful spirit.
